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is the Hybrid Bridge Magnetic Deflection Amplifier. This invention utilizes a magnetic deflection amplifier that is connected to a linear amplifier and a three-pole switch. The switch connects the deflection coil to ground during active scanning and to a high voltage rail based on the polarity of the retrace current. This design results in fast retrace times and reduced voltage requirements on the linear amplifier.
Another significant patent is the System and Method to Improve the Quality of Reproduced Images on a Film. This innovation enhances the quality of video transfers from film by scanning extra lines to minimize vertical aliasing. The method involves vertical sample rate reduction, which produces the correct number of video output lines. By filtering multiple adjacent lines, high-frequency noise is reduced, leading to improved image quality.
